Abstract

This paper presents an image encryption scheme based on complete shuffling algorithm: limited in the skew tent-map-predicated image cryptosystem and chaotic substitution box transformation. The proposed image encryption algorithm provides extra confusion due to the inclusion of a chaotic S-box. It is well known from the literature that simple image encryption based on a total shuffling scheme is not secure against a chosen cipher text attack. We then projected an extended algorithm which does well against a chosen cipher text attack. Furthermore we analyze the proposed technique for unified average changing intensity (UACI) and NPCR analysis to determine its strength.
